Output 7331112ebae53023f5e43864944a02e597901a277100f93fd84b52925abf4a2a:57

value
78838
script pubkey
OP_0 OP_PUSHBYTES_32 bf172218c34a753e8495d45eeba60ae7207e179d579df8258c7b20767443324e
address
bc1qhutjyxxrff6napy4630whfs2uus8u9ua27wlsfvv0vs8vazrxf8qjukmyh
transaction
7331112ebae53023f5e43864944a02e597901a277100f93fd84b52925abf4a2a
spent
true